Meet Helical Insight: A Next-Generation BI and Visualization Platform

 

Helical Insight, developed by Helical IT Solutions, is a comprehensive open-source data visualization and analytics platform designed for organizations that want complete control over their BI environment. Unlike many proprietary tools, it allows businesses to deploy on-premise, integrate seamlessly with existing systems, and customize almost every layer of the platform.

 

Helical Insight is built with a modular and API-driven architecture, making it both developer-friendly and business-user-accessible. Users can connect to multiple data sources—from relational databases like MySQL and PostgreSQL to big data platforms such as Hadoop and Spark—and create interactive reports and dashboards with ease.

Key Visualization Capabilities That Rival Tableau

 

Helical Insight offers an impressive set of open source data visualization capabilities that rival, and in some cases surpass, those of Tableau. Here are some highlights:

 

Advanced Dashboarding: Users can design rich, interactive dashboards using a drag-and-drop interface. The platform supports charts, graphs, maps, and custom visualizations that respond dynamically to user inputs.

 

·         Customization and Extensibility: Being open source, Helical Insight allows developers to create custom visualization components using JavaScript, HTML, and CSS. This flexibility enables businesses to build visuals tailored to their unique analytical needs.

·         Ad Hoc and Self-Service Reporting: Business users can easily build reports without writing SQL queries. For technical users, Helical Insight offers scripting and APIs for advanced customization.

·         Real-Time Analytics: The platform supports real-time data connections, enabling users to monitor live metrics and performance indicators.

·         Integration Capabilities: Helical Insight integrates seamlessly with authentication systems, REST APIs, and external data sources, allowing it to fit perfectly within enterprise IT ecosystems.
